If you want to apply for a Dutch VoIP number, you must have a company in the Netherlands or be resident. That is why we ask for proof of this, for example by means of a rental contract or showing the energy bill of your Dutch address.<\/p>\n<\/div><\/div><\/div><\/div><\/div>
Every telecom provider in the Netherlands is obliged to perform an address verification. This means that it must be checked whether you as a customer actually have an address in the Netherlands. If not, no Dutch telephone number may be issued.<\/p>\n
Performing an address verification can easily be done by, for example, showing a rental agreement or a utility bill of the address of your home or business. That’s all it really is!<\/p>\n<\/div><\/div><\/div>
